My World Cup Soccer playfield looks pretty good. But I noticed that I can feel the edges of the inserts when I was cleaning it. I'm worried about future damage, even though it is a home use pin. I have considered clear coating it, but I'm new to doing that. I've been considering getting a new playfield since I've done playfield swaps before. However, I was at the Houston Arcade Expo last weekend and noticed the WCS as well as a few other games had a playfield protector. I didn't even realize at first they had protectors on. Once I started really examining them I could see some wear and scratches, but nothing unsightly. But it got me thinking.....

Is the playfield protector a nice long term option? Will it hold up and stay nice or does it mark up pretty easily? I'm not against a playfield swap on my WCS, but I have other projects in the works that need more attention. So is a playfield protector worth the time and effort or should I just hold out for a playfield swap?
